1. Understanding the “Your First $10k Workshop” Concept

1.1 What Does “Your First $10k Workshop” Really Mean?

At its core, Your First $10k Workshop represents a focused business model where knowledge is packaged into a structured, outcome-driven workshop that solves a specific problem for a defined audience. The goal is not scale at the beginning, but proof of concept, confidence, and cash flow.

Felix Tay’s approach centers on helping individuals identify what they already know, refine it into a compelling promise, and deliver it in a format people are willing to pay for.

1.2 Why Workshops Are One of the Fastest Monetization Models

Workshops sit at the intersection of education, coaching, and consulting. Compared to courses or memberships, workshops:

  • Deliver results in a short timeframe

  • Create urgency and commitment

  • Require minimal tech infrastructure

  • Allow premium pricing due to live or interactive elements

This makes the Felix Tay – Your First $10k Workshop framework especially effective for beginners who want fast validation.

4. Structuring a $10k Workshop Offer

4.1 Defining the Transformation

A high-converting workshop must clearly define:

  • The problem being solved

  • The process used to solve it

  • The tangible outcome

This is a foundational pillar of Felix Tay – Your First $10k Workshop.

4.2 Pricing Strategy for Your First Workshop

Rather than selling low-ticket access, the framework encourages value-based pricing. For example:

  • 20 participants × $500 = $10,000

  • 10 participants × $1,000 = $10,000

The emphasis is on results delivered, not hours taught.

4.3 Workshop Format Options

Workshops can be delivered in multiple formats:

  • Live virtual sessions

  • Hybrid live + recordings

  • Intensive 1–2 day workshops

  • Multi-session cohorts over a week

The format should support the promised outcome, not overwhelm the creator.


5. Creating the Workshop Content

5.1 Teaching What Matters (Not Everything)

A common mistake is over-teaching. The Felix Tay workshop approach focuses on:

  • Critical steps only

  • Actionable frameworks

  • Templates and examples

  • Live implementation guidance

Participants should leave with progress, not just notes.

5.2 Designing a Logical Flow

A strong workshop typically follows this structure:

  1. Problem clarity and mindset reset

  2. Core framework introduction

  3. Step-by-step execution process

  4. Live application or case study

  5. Troubleshooting and Q&A

This flow reinforces confidence and trust.
